The homework is one of the core components of the course. All required
readings and (almost all) problems will be taken from the text ISM.
The weekly assignments will consist of multiple parts which we describe here.
-
Reading: Typically (with the notable exception of the first week) you will
be reading one chapter each week. It is expected that you do an initial
reading of the chapter prior to the relevant lectures, and then read it
through more carefully after the lectures. It is essential that
you are actively engaging the text both
before and after that material is presented
in lecture.
-
Exercises: Interspersed throughout the text are various Exercises
(which are distinct from the Problems at the end of each chapter).
It is expected that you will do all of the exercises in the course of
your giving that chapter a careful reading.
-
Written Problems: Each week a number of problems (and occasionally
exercises) will be assigned for you to carefully write up and hand in.
These problems are the heart of the course. These assignments will be
graded and returned to you in a timely manner.
Students are very strongly encouraged to work together on the homework,
however each student must write up his/her assignment individually,
in their own words.
The emphasis in the homework will be twofold. It will contribute
significantly to the understanding and development of the new material
which we will encounter each week. Secondly, it will be a forum for students
to hone their skills at writing clear precise proofs.
Due to the fundamental importance of the homework,
it will account for a very large portion (2/3) of the course grade. .
